Pennyrile Electric Clarifies New Second Meter Tax

Pennyrile Electric customers with more than one electric meter are receiving letters concerning a change in the state tax law passed by the Kentucky General Assembly.

The letter references a change made by House Bill 8 that calls for the taxation of a second dwelling or residence with a separate electric meter. The letter also contains a form that allows customers to apply for an exemption from the new tax in certain situations.

Pennyrile Electric’s Vice President of Member Services Brent Gilkey says not all of the cooperative’s customers will be affected.
